What is Aluminum Die Casting?


The aluminum die casting process involves forcing molten aluminum into a mold cavity under high pressure. This technique delivers high-volume production of complex metal parts. Thanks to its lightweight nature, aluminum is a popular choice in fields including automotive, aerospace, and electronics.

Benefits of Aluminum Die Casting



  • Lightweight and strong

  • Highly resistant to corrosion

  • Outstanding thermal properties

  • Rapid production capabilities

What is a Machining Center?


Machining centers refer to advanced CNC systems capable of performing multiple machining operations like drilling and finishing in a single setup. Such machines increase productivity and shorten machining times.

Types of Machining Centers



  • Vertical Machining Centers

  • Horizontal Machining Centers (HMC)

  • 5-Axis CNC Centers


Why Choose a Machining Center?


These centers allow enhanced efficiency, exact operations, and reduced downtime, which makes them ideal for mass production.

CNC vs Aluminum Die Casting


Choosing between die casting aluminum and CNC Machining, think about factors like production volume, accuracy specifications, material selection, and budget constraints. Generally, aluminum casting is ideal for large batch manufacturing, while CNC machining are perfect for lower volume production with high precision.
